Обмен с 1С:Торговля и Склад 7.7

#
Re: Обмен с 1С:Торговля и Склад 7.7
На всякий случай - это не претензия. Магазин очень хорош, особенно учитывая возможности free версии. Просто пожелание. По моему скромному мнению, экспорт заказов с сайта в 7.7 будет очень востребован.
#
Re: Обмен с 1С:Торговля и Склад 7.7
Если столь необходимо выгружать заказы именно в CSV, пришлите ссылку на описание формата в котором необходимо выгружать заказы или хотя бы пример, охватывающий все нюансы выгрузки. Мы проанализируем и реализуем данный функционал в ближайшее время.
#
Re: Обмен с 1С:Торговля и Склад 7.7
У вас уже есть этот формат, есть почти весь файл, и даже есть столбец под товар! Но он пустой.

Вот ваш файл:
№  Дата Заказч. Фамил. Сум. Вес Опл. Отм. Дата опл. Статус заказа Товар

нужно все то же самое + колонки Артикул, Код пользователя, Количество.

В случае нескольких товаров в заказе - строчки просто дублируются - номер, дата, клиент - остаются теми же, меняются только Товар и Количество.

Засунуть выгрузку логично в меню Заказы - Экспорт заказов (аналогично Товары - Экспорт товаров)

Простейший пример бизнес-процесса в связке с 1С выглядит так - в начале дня специально обученный человек выгружает товары из 1С в магазин, чтобы обновить их цену и наличие. Магазин торгует ими в течение дня. В конце дня человек выгружает Заказы из магазина в 1С и делает на основании их Реализации, либо сразу загружает в Реализации. И видит в 1С картину продаж за день. Все. Для этого и нужен обмен.

Остальное - детали реализации. Работа непосредственно с SQL базой, или через промежуточные файлы (csv,xls,xml,txt). Из последних проще всего работать с csv и txt, если вы наберете в яндексе "выгрузка в csv" - как минимум половина результатов будет связана с 1С.
#
Re: Обмен с 1С:Торговля и Склад 7.7
asto писал(а):
строчки просто дублируются — номер, дата, клиент — остаются теми же, меняются только Товар и Количество.
Дубляж можно убрать если все товары заказа писать в одну строку с заказом. Например:

"Заказ 1";"Поле заказа 1";"Поле заказа 2";"Поле заказа 3";"Товар заказа 1";"Товар заказа 2";"Товар заказа 3"
"Заказ 2";"Поле заказа 1";"Поле заказа 2";"Поле заказа 3";"Товар заказа 1";"Товар заказа 2";"Товар заказа 3"
#
Re: Обмен с 1С:Торговля и Склад 7.7
Лучше дублировать, т.к. при разборе файла проще оперировать с жестким количеством полей. Грубо говоря, например, знаем, что поле №10 это наменование товара, а №11 артикул. А если товары перечислять в строку - то мы уже не знаем точно, что в поле №11 - артикул первого, или наименование второго товара.
Модератор
#
Re: Обмен с 1С:Торговля и Склад 7.7
asto,
мы все же при экспорте товаров используем вариант построковой информации, поэтому вероятно экспорт заказов будет вестись по той же схеме, вычислить где какое поле не составит большого труда.
#
Re: Обмен с 1С:Торговля и Склад 7.7
В-общем, да.
Авторизация